Output 68ddb3731077835bb0388f1506221164f3bc82d0db497ae77492c41af5f4a171:79

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 852c850394e3077c70d5be031ba944f716d2a934
address
bc1qs5kg2qu5uvrhcux4hcp3h22y7utd92f5dn9kpg
transaction
68ddb3731077835bb0388f1506221164f3bc82d0db497ae77492c41af5f4a171
spent
true